Critics blast Greg Abbott for being there as Trump signed order to close Education Department
Texas Gov. Greg Abbott is drawing fire for appearing at Thursday's White House photo op where President Donald Trump signed an executive order aimed at eliminating the Education Department. Trump — who's criticized the department as wasteful and corrupted by progressive ideology — has publicly said he's tasked Education Secretary Linda McMahon, an anti-union billionaire and WWE co-founder, with scrapping the agency. While the president has the ability to cut staff and resources, the department likely can't be abolished without an act of Congress, experts maintain.
